    Kinetics of phase transition from lamellar to hexagonally packed cylinders for a triblock copolymer in a selective solvent

    We examined the kinetics of the transformation from the lamellar (LAM) to the hexagonally packed cylinder (HEX) phase for the triblock copolymer, polystyrene-b-poly (ethylene-co-butylene)-b-polystyrene (SEBS) in dibutyl phthalate (DBP), a selective solvent for polystyrene (PS), using time-resolved small angle x-ray scattering (SAXS). We observe the HEX phase with the EB block in the cores at a lower temperature than the LAM phase due to the solvent selectivity of DBP for the PS block. Analysis of the SAXS data for a deep temperature quench well below the LAM-HEX transition shows that the transformation occurs in a one-step process. We calculate the scattering using a geometric model of rippled layers with adjacent layers totally out of phase during the transformation. The agreement of the calculations with the data further supports the continuous transformation mechanism from the LAM to HEX for a deep quench. In contrast, for a shallow quench close to the OOT we find agreement with a two-step nucleation and growth mechanism

    Kinetics of HEX-BCC Transition in a Triblock Copolymer in a Selective Solvent: Time Resolved Small Angle X-ray Scattering Measurements and Model Calculations

    Time-resolved small angle x-ray scattering (SAXS) was used to examine the kinetics of the transition from HEX cylinders to BCC spheres at various temperatures in poly(styrene-b- ethylene-co-butylene-b-styrene) (SEBS) in mineral oil, a selective solvent for the middle EB block. Temperature-ramp SAXS and rheology measurements show the HEX to BCC order-order transition (OOT) at ~127 oC and order-disorder transition (ODT) at ~180 oC. We also observed the metastability limit of HEX in BCC with a spinodal temperature, Ts ~ 150 oC. The OOT exhibits 3 stages and occurs via a nucleation and growth mechanism when the final temperature Tf < Ts. Spinodal decomposition in a continuous ordering system was seen when Ts< Tf < TODT. We observed that HEX cylinders transform to disordered spheres via a transient BCC state. We develop a geometrical model of coupled anisotropic fluctuations and calculate the scattering which shows very good agreement with the SAXS data. The splitting of the primary peak into two peaks when the cylinder spacing and modulation wavelength are incommensurate predicted by the model is confirmed by analysis of the SAXS data

    Can direct union elections increase workers’ economic wellbeing in China?: testing effects and explaining mechanisms

    Direct union elections, a new institutional arrangement in grassroots trade unions in China, have been introduced experimentally in coastal regions since 2000. Using matched employer–employee data, this study examines the effects of direct union elections on workers’ economic wellbeing. Results reveal that 1) union members with directly elected leaders receive higher wages than those without and 2) direct union elections are positively correlated with worker satisfaction. Additional evidences suggest that effects of direct elections work through stronger union leadership and harmonious industrial relations, resembling the voice-response face of unionism. The effect of direct elections significantly weakens or disappears when we exclude the large firms from the analysis. Meanwhile, the effect of union membership regains its significance. We argue that direct elections are a government-sponsored experiment in which large firms are selected to form an incentive-compatible framework among local governments, firms, and workers for explaining union effects with Chinese characteristics

    Kinetics of Hexagonal Cylinders to Face-centered Cubic Spheres Transition of Triblock Copolymer in Selective Solvent: Brownian Dynamics Simulation

    The kinetics of the transformation from the hexagonal packed cylinder (HEX) phase to the face-centered-cubic (FCC) phase was simulated using Brownian Dynamics for an ABA triblock copolymer in a selective solvent for the A block. The kinetics was obtained by instantaneously changing either the temperature of the system or the well-depth of the Lennard-Jones potential. Detailed analysis showed that the transformation occurred via a rippling mechanism. The simulation results indicated that the order-order transformation (OOT) was a nucleation and growth process when the temperature of the system instantly jumped from 0.8 to 0.5. The time evolution of the structure factor obtained by Fourier Transformation showed that the peak intensities of the HEX and FCC phases could be fit well by an Avrami equation

    China's great migration: the impact of the reduction in trade policy uncertainty

    We analyze the effect of China's integration into the world economy on workers in the country and show that one important channel of impact has been internal migration. Specifically, we study the changes in internal migration rates triggered by the reduction in trade policy uncertainty faced by Chinese exporters in the U.S. This reduction is characterized by plausibly exogenous variation across sectors, which we use to construct a local measure of treatment, at the level of a Chinese prefecture, following Bartik (1991). This allows us to estimate a difference-in-difference empirical specification based on variation across Chinese prefectures before and after 2001. We find that prefectures facing the average decline in trade policy uncertainty experience an 18 percent increase in their internal in-migration rate this result is driven by migrants who are "non-hukou", skilled, and in their prime working age. Finally, in those prefectures, working hours of "native" unskilled workers significantly increase - while the employment rates of neither native workers nor internal migrants change
